Spectacular farewell: Giant aircraft inspires at Leipzig Airport!
At Leipzig/Halle Airport, the Antonov An-124-100 of the airline "Maximus Air" caused excitement when it started an impressive flight. With a cargo dream of 850 square meters, the monster aircraft can transport 120 tons and weighs remarkable 392 tons when fully loaded. Plane Spotter Valentin Ausic, who became a witness of the start, particularly emphasized the extraordinary "Wing Wave" maneuver, in which the machine wobbled when lifting. For him, this sight was simply breathtaking and a Highlight in the world of aircraft lovers.
The AN-124 of "Maximus Air" makes regular stops in Leipzig for maintenance work and, in addition to the domestic Antonov An-124 of the Ukrainian "Antonov Airlines", is one of the few of its kind in the region.
